Dimitrios Lialios ( Greek Δημήτριος Λιάλιος , * 1869 in Patras ; † March 13, 1940 ibid) was a Greek composer of classical music.

Lialios studied at the Royal Music School in Munich with Ludwig Thuille . Between 1919 and 1935 Lialios was the Greek Vice Consul in Munich. Lialios was the first Greek composer to turn to chamber music.

He created more than 100 works, including 22 orchestral compositions, 14 chamber music works, a requiem , an opera and 2 compositions for Greek Orthodox liturgies.
